Impact XM argues that the events industry survives disruption not through rigid planning but through adaptive leadership rooted in clear purpose and inclusive representation. The channel profiles entrepreneurs, hospitality executives, and philanthropic leaders who pivoted during the pandemic, showing that success rests on understanding your mission, embracing flexibility in logistics, and ensuring diverse voices shape the work.

How do event leaders overcome self-doubt and imposter syndrome?
By reconnecting with the purpose and meaning of their work, not by pursuing external markers of success. Courtney Stanley notes that visible success masks the struggle required to achieve it.

By embracing flexibility in decision-making and allowing attendees and clients to commit to participation details closer to the event date, rather than requiring advance certainty on headcount and format.
